Blessed is He who has placed in the sky great stars and placed therein a [burning] lamp and luminous moon. 61 It is He who has made the night and the day, one proceeding the other, for whoever wants to take heed or give thanks. 62 And the bondmen of the Most Gracious who walk upon the earth humbly, and when the ignorant address them they answer, “Peace”. (Good –bye) 63 and those who spend the night prostrating themselves, and standing before their Lord, 64 who pray, "Lord, protect us from the torment of hell; it is a great loss. 65 verily, how evil an abode and a station!"; 66 And those who, when they spend, are neither prodigal nor grudging; and there is ever a firm station between the two; 67 and who never invoke any [imaginary] deity side by side with God, and do not take any human beings life - [the life] which God has willed to be sacred - otherwise than in [the pursuit of] justice, and do not commit adultery. And [know that] he who commits aught thereof shall [not only] meet with a full requital 68 he shall have his suffering doubled on the Day of Resurrection and he will abide forever in disgrace, 69 Except one who repents and accepts faith and does good deeds – so Allah will turn their evil deeds into virtues; and Allah is Oft Forgiving, Most Merciful. 70 Whosoever repents and does the right, will have turned back to God by way of repentance; 71 And those who do not give false testimony, and when they pass near some indecency, they pass by it saving their honour. 72 And those who, when they are reminded of the revelations of their Lord, fall not deaf and blind thereat. 73 And they who say: O our Lord! grant us in our wives and our offspring the joy of our eyes, and make us guides to those who guard (against evil). 74 They will be rewarded for their perseverance with lofty mansions in empyrean where they will be received with greetings of peace and salutations, 75 They shall abide in it forever; what an excellent abode and place of stay. 76 Say, "What would my Lord care for you if not for your supplication?" For you [disbelievers] have denied, so your denial is going to be adherent. 77
